    <title>2025 (12) TMI 1354 - ITAT BANGALORE</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=783814</link>
    <description>Whether estimated business profit should be computed at 10% or 6% was the dominant issue. The Tribunal held that where income is to be estimated, the estimate must be reasonable and consistent with accepted past results absent any material change in facts. Since the taxpayer adopted 6% based on earlier assessment orders accepted by the Department, and the appellate authority neither identified any distinguishing features nor supported 10% with comparables from similar businesses, enhancement to 10% lacked legal and factual basis. The 6% margin was upheld and the appeal was allowed.</description>
